Simplistically it makes sense for drivers to pay for the roads they use.

I actually agree, but there are two things:

1. The Feds still haven't gotten rid of the ban on tolling existing lanes on federally-funded highways, and

2. I believe that tolls should only be imposed on stretches of previously-free highway that just underwent a major project, such as a widening or rehabilitation. The tolls can be used to pay back part or all of the funding, and then fund the maintenance into perpetuity.
